    Hi everyone. I' m an Italian-Scottish who now lives in italy after years spent in Edinburgh (but I hope to come back soon...). For all the ones traveling to Milan without a celtic end ticket, try to purchase on section 220 or close. That's where the Italian Celts CSC are going to be. If the away end won't be sold out we'll all end up in, if not, we'll just stay together in those sections. These guys will be in Piazza Duomo before the game, they should be around 100 and with their banners you can't miss them. If you want to go on your own stay away from Curva Nord, but you won't have any problem to get in with your celtic gear on. For any help I can give please just ask, Hail Hail
